Institutional Investors' Top KOSDAQ Buys on the 9th: Robotis and Simmtech Lead

Electronic Technology · Semiconductors · yonhap_finance · 2026-09-09

Institutional investors on the KOSDAQ market heavily bought Robotis and Simmtech on the 9th, while selling off shares of PharmaResearch and Silicon2.

What Happened

Institutional Buying: On the 9th, institutional investors on the KOSDAQ market were net buyers of Robotis, followed by Simmtech and Eugene Technology. Stocks favored by institutions generally showed resilience throughout the trading session.

Key Acquisitions: Institutions also added a diverse range of stocks to their portfolios, including Comico, RF Materials, and EcoPro. The data highlights a sustained institutional interest in robotics and semiconductor-related companies.

Institutional Selling: Conversely, institutions were net sellers of PharmaResearch, Silicon2, and Comico. These sales likely reflect portfolio rebalancing strategies rather than a fundamental shift in outlook for these companies.
